Understanding the Cost of Private Jet to Las Vegas

The cost of private jet to Las Vegas can vary widely depending on several factors. Whether you’re planning a luxurious getaway or a quick business trip, knowing what to expect financially can make the journey smoother.

Factors Influencing the Cost

When considering the cost of private jet to Las Vegas, several key factors come into play. First, the distance of your departure location to Las Vegas is crucial. A flight from Los Angeles, for example, will generally be less expensive than one from New York. The type of aircraft you choose also plays a significant role. Smaller jets are typically more economical, while larger, more luxurious models come with higher price tags.

Choosing the Right Aircraft

Aircraft selection is one of the primary considerations when evaluating the cost of private jet to Las Vegas. Light jets like the Learjet 35 may cost around $3,000 per hour, while midsize jets such as the Hawker 800XP might set you back about $4,000 per hour. For those seeking ultimate luxury, heavy jets like the Gulfstream G550 can cost upwards of $8,000 per hour.

Quick takeaway: Consider your group size and travel needs when selecting an aircraft to ensure a balance between cost and comfort.

Additional Costs to Consider

Aside from the hourly rate, other costs can add up quickly. Landing fees, overnight crew charges, and catering can significantly influence the final bill. A quick tip: always ask for a detailed breakdown from the charter company to avoid surprises.

Tips for Reducing Costs

If the cost of private jet to Las Vegas seems steep, consider some strategies to reduce expenses. Empty leg flights, where jets return to their home base without passengers, can offer significant savings. Also, consider sharing the flight with other travelers to split the cost.

FAQ

What is the average cost of a private jet to Las Vegas?

The average cost can range from $3,000 to $8,000 per hour, depending on the aircraft type and additional services.

How far in advance should I book a private jet?

It’s best to book at least a week in advance to secure the desired aircraft and schedule.

Can I bring pets on a private jet?

Yes, most private jets are pet-friendly, but it’s advisable to inform the charter company in advance.
